Water Carnival Bike Ride Information

February 19, 2012 by CarlaR Leave a Comment

Enjoy the Festivities – June 16 in Hutchinson

The Watercarnival Bike Ride is an official event of the Hutchinson Water Carnival, which will be celebrating its 70th year in 2012. The Watercarnival is a week long celebration of summer, sponsored by the Hutchinson Jaycees, with events scheduled each day between June 11th and 17th. On Saturday, June 16th, in addition to the bike ride, there are other events and celebrations scheduled around town. Enjoy bicycling thru the scenic lake country around Hutchinson, and enjoy the other Watercarnival festivities.

Support Great Causes

The Watercarnival Bike Ride is sponsored by the Hutchinson Rotary Club and Outdoor Motion Bike Shop. Proceeds from the bike ride go to Rotary Club local and international projects including scholarships, literacy, clean water, and polio eradication.

Hutchinson is an easy one hour drive west of the Twin Cities on Hwy 7, one hour south of St. Cloud on Hwy 15, or 45 minutes north of New Ulm on Hwy 15

Ride One of Two Great Rides

The Watercarnival Bike Ride offers two very scenic, enjoyable rides:

20 mile ride
Bike from town to a rest stop in Piepenberg County Park, on Belle Lake. Then loop thru part of the lake country, and return to town on a route that includes biking along the Crow River on the Luce Line trail.

65 mile ride
Follow the same route at the 20 mile ride from town to the Piepenberg rest stop. Then turn north and travel thru much of the scenic lake country and pass thru the towns of Dassel and Litchfield, before returning back to Hutchinson. This route also includes biking along the Crow River on the Luce Line trail, and includes two additional rest stops.

Welcome, Kate!

October 26, 2011 by CarlaR 1 Comment

DaSeul (Kate) Kang is Hutchinson Rotary’s current foreign exchange student from Anyang, Gyeonggi-do, South Korea. Kate turned 18 shortly after her arrival in Minnesota, and she is currently in the 11th grade at New Century Academy. Kate’s interests include photography and music. Kate joined the “School of Rock” where she gets to play her ukulele and write music with a group of peers and local musician Jason Schooler. Kate is also getting ready to compete on the school’s Math League Team.

Since her arrival in Minnesota, Kate has attended the Renaissance Festival, shopped at the Mall of America, and of course, toured the World’s Largest Ball of Twine in Darwin. Kate has had the opportunity to fish and kayak for the first time on a Minnesota Lake, make lefse with her host family, and ride with pheasant hunting in western South Dakota.

Kate has presented to Hutchinson Rotary once already, during an October meeting. She will present again in a few months, which you’ll want to make sure to attend. Kate brought many interesting pictures, stories, and information with her to share with her new friends. She is willing to share her culture with others, and has made many ethnic Korean dishes for her host family and friends at school, including Korean sushi, kim chi, and barbequed beef and chicken dishes.

Isabelle (host sister) and Kate

Kate will be in Hutchinson from August 2011 until June 2012, staying with three host families. Her current host family is Steve and Beth Gasser.
